Leaky HVAC Systems: A Common Cause of Water Damage in Rockwall, TX

You live in Rockwall, TX, where warm summers and occasional thunderstorms can cause your HVAC system to work overtime. Unfortunately, this can lead to a common problem: leaks. When your air conditioner’s condensate drain line becomes clogged or the unit itself develops a crack, water can start pooling around the unit. It’s not just a minor issue – standing water can cause significant damage to your walls, ceilings, and floors. That’s why it’s crucial to address the problem quickly and professionally. How Our HVAC Leak Water Removal Process Works

When you hire our team for HVAC Leak Water Removal, you can expect a comprehensive process that includes assessment, extraction, drying, and prevention. Here’s what you can expect from our expert technicians:

Step 1: Assessment and Inspection

We’ll inspect the affected area to identify the source of the leak and assess the damage. Our team will check for signs of water damage, including warping, discoloration, and musty odors. We’ll create a plan to address the issue.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We’ll use specialized equipment to extract water from the affected area. Our team will use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to remove standing water and extract water from walls, ceilings, and floors. We’ll reduce damage to your property.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

We’ll use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and fans to dry out the affected area. Our team will work to circulate air, speed up evaporation, and prevent further moisture buildup. We’ll ensure your property is dry and safe.

Step 4: Prevention and Repair

We’ll identify and repair any underlying issues that caused the leak. Our team will inspect and repair or replace damaged parts, such as condensate drain lines, to prevent future leaks. We’ll provide recommendations for maintenance and upkeep.

Warning Signs You Need HVAC Leak Water Removal

Ignoring the signs of a leaky HVAC system can lead to costly damage and health risks. Watch for these warning signs: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Unpleasant odors in your home or office can show a leak. If you notice a persistent musty smell, especially in areas near the HVAC unit, it’s time to call a professional. Don’t ignore the signs.

Water Stains and Warping

Visible water stains or warping on walls, ceilings, or floors show a leak. If you notice any of these signs,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age. Call us today!

Increased Energy Bills

Unusual spikes in your energy bills can show a leak. If your energy bills are higher than usual, it may be a sign that your HVAC system is working harder due to a leak. Check your bills and call us.

Visible Leaks or Water Spots

Visible leaks or water spots near the HVAC unit show a leak. If you notice any signs of water leaking or water spots,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ly. Don’t delay!

Unusual Noises or Vibrations

Unusual noises or vibrations from the HVAC unit can show a leak. If you notice any unusual sounds or vibrations, it may be a sign that your HVAC system is malfunctioning due to a leak. Check your unit and call us.

HVAC Leak Water Removal Cost In Rockwall, TX

The cost of HVAC Leak Water Removal services in Rockwall, TX, varies based on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will assess the situation and provide a customized estimate.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and drying $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of leak, and equipment needed.
Condensate drain line repair or replacement $200 – $1,000 Location and complexity of repair or replacement.
Mold remediation and prevention $1,000 – $3,000 Size of affected area, type of mold, and equipment needed.
HVAC system inspection and repair $500 – $2,000 Complexity of repair, type of HVAC system, and equipment needed.
